掌握Redis集群的启动与停止(redis集群启动与停止)
Redis集群是一种灵活,功能齐全的内存数据结构,可以实现高可用性,高性能,高可扩展性,而且可以比较容易的搭建和管理,在搭建集群的时候,经常会有启动Redis集群和停止Redis集群的操作,下面主要介绍Redis集群的启动和停止的操作。
一、Redis集群的启动
1.我们需要将Redis集群关联起来,主要通过node节点间的关联;
2.然后,配置Redis集群配置文件,里面包含了集群节点、数据库参数和集群中端口信息;
3.接下来,依次启动每个节点,可以使用redis-cli命令来启动,主要有两个参数:–cluster-enable 、–cluster-config-file;
4.验证Redis集群的正常运行,可以使用命令 cluter info 来查看Redis集群的运行状态。
例如:
$ redis-cli –cluster-enable –cluster-config-file nodes.conf –cluster-node-timeout 5000
二、Redis集群的停止
1.让其他Node节点变成不可写状态,也就是对节点进行无写入操作;
2.然后,禁用Redis集群,可以使用CLUSTER DISABLE 命令来禁用集群;
3.接着,停止其他Node节点,可以使用CLUSTER RESET 命令来将Redis集群里的其他节点置为“正常”状态;
4.停止节点的Redis实例,可以使用REDIS SHUTDOWN 命令来停止掉集群中的其他节点。
例如:
$ redis-cli CLUSTER DISABLE
总结起来,Redis集群的启动和停止是一件非常重要的操作,主要是确保集群的正确运行。在进行这些操作之前,用户需要理解集群的结构,并了解每一步操作所做的事情,这样才能真正实现Redis集群的高可用性,高性能,高可扩展性。